Noise Pollution

Noise pollution refers to any unwanted or excessive sound that disrupts the natural environment and causes negative effects on human health and well-being. It is a growing concern in modern society, where technology and urbanization have led to a significant increase in noise levels. According to the World Health Organization (WHO), noise pollution is the second-largest environmental threat to public health, after air pollution.

Sources of Noise Pollution

Noise pollution can come from many sources, including transportation, construction sites, industrial facilities, airports, and even recreational activities such as music concerts and sports events. Some common sources of noise pollution include:

  1. Traffic noise: This is the most common source of noise pollution, and it includes noise from cars, trucks, buses, and motorcycles. Traffic noise can be particularly harmful to those living in urban areas, as it can be constant and prolonged.
  2. Industrial noise: Industrial facilities such as factories, power plants, and construction sites can produce high levels of noise pollution. This can have a significant impact on the health and well-being of nearby residents and workers.
  3. Aircraft noise: Airports are a major source of noise pollution, and the noise from aircraft can be particularly harmful to those living near airports. The noise can be constant and can disrupt sleep patterns, leading to sleep deprivation and other health problems.
  4. Recreational noise: Recreational activities such as music concerts and sports events can also produce high levels of noise pollution. These events can be particularly harmful to those living nearby, as the noise can be sudden and unexpected.

Effects of Noise Pollution

Noise pollution can have a range of negative effects on human health and well-being. Some of the most common effects of noise pollution include:

  1. Hearing damage: Prolonged exposure to high levels of noise can lead to hearing damage, including hearing loss and tinnitus.
  2. Sleep disturbance: Noise pollution can disrupt sleep patterns, leading to sleep deprivation and other health problems such as fatigue and irritability.
  3. Cardiovascular problems: Exposure to high levels of noise can increase the risk of cardiovascular problems such as hypertension, heart disease, and stroke.
  4. Cognitive impairment: Noise pollution can impair cognitive function, including memory and attention.
  5. Stress and anxiety: Noise pollution can cause stress and anxiety, leading to a range of health problems such as depression, anxiety disorders, and even suicide.

Measures to Control Noise Pollution

There are several measures that can be taken to control noise pollution. These include:

  1. Planning and zoning: Proper planning and zoning can help to reduce noise pollution by separating noisy activities from residential areas.
  2. Noise barriers: Noise barriers such as walls and fences can help to reduce noise levels from sources such as highways and railways.
  3. Noise insulation: Proper insulation of buildings can help to reduce noise levels inside the building.
  4. Noise regulations: Governments can enact noise regulations to limit the amount of noise that can be produced by different sources.
  5. Education and awareness: Education and awareness campaigns can help to raise awareness about the negative effects of noise pollution and encourage individuals to take action to reduce their own noise levels.
